| Issue | Solution | |-------|----------| | “No update available” but you know a newer version exists | Try manual update with file from ISP. | | Update fails at 50% / “Invalid file” | Ensure you downloaded firmware for (not V2 or other models). | | Router becomes unresponsive after update | Perform a factory reset (press reset pin hole for 10+ seconds), then reconfigure. | | Cannot access web interface after update | Reset network adapter, use 192.168.1.1 , check Ethernet/Wi-Fi connection. |

Tighten the coaxial cable on the back of the router and the wall jack. Poor signal quality (high uncorrectable error rates) can cause firmware downloads to fail midway through. If your router is supplied by an Internet
